I purchased all of my bicycles from a now closed shop in Philadelphia called the Bicycle Stable. It was a fantastic bike shop that was next to my Philly house. The owner, Chaz, was a former bike racer and was always happy to chat about biking. I miss that kind of relationship with a bike shop owner, but the bikes keep rolling thanks to help from Bob Anderson - Bike Mechanic Extraordinaire. Here are the bikes that I ride:

  • 2006 Bianchi Volpe Steel 105/Tiagra - cyclo-cross bicycle frame with road wheels for commuting and city riding. A solid frame that's been my workhorse for years. I did crack the frame on this bike, but it was replaced under warranty with a 2008 Volpe. Years later, I'd break that 2008 frame, and Chaz told me he'd welded and repaired my old 2006 frame, so that's what I'm still riding.
  • 2007 Bianchi C2C 928 Carbon 105 Compact - a quality carbon touring bicycle that Chaz gave me a great deal on.
  • 1999 Giant Farrago SE - a heavy steel frame hybrid that I use for hauling groceries, cases of beer, etc. It's a nice upright bike and was the first bike that really got me into long rides.
  • Burley Child Trailer - I modified the trailer to safely carry two dogs or large and/or heavy cargo. I've used this to haul bagged soil, taken it bike camping, and put it to good use.
